Utilizing slip-resistant cushions can significantly enhance your experience with upholstered seating. Opt for soft cushions that complement the existing design while providing friction against movement. This small adjustment can lead to great comfort.

Investing in textured throws or decorative blankets is another practical solution. These accessories not only enhance aesthetics but also create a textured surface that increases grip, reducing the tendency to slide off. Choose materials with a bit of heft to them for maximum effectiveness.

Regular maintenance of your seating is critical. Clean with appropriate solutions designed for the material to maintain its texture and grip. Avoid using products that create excess shine, as these can make surfaces slick.

Strategically placing non-slip pads can prevent unwanted movement. These pads can be cut to size and placed underneath cushions or even on the floor to create a more stable setup. They’re an inexpensive yet efficient solution that makes a significant difference.

Lastly, consider adjusting your seating arrangement. Positioning furniture against walls or other pieces can provide additional support, reducing the likelihood of slipping. A well-thought-out layout can transform your space into a comfortable retreat.

Maintaining Stability on Smooth Seating

Applying a non-slip coating, such as silicone spray or a specialized furniture grip, can significantly enhance traction. These products create a textured surface that reduces movement on a polished texture.

Using strategically placed cushions or seat pads will also help. Selecting materials with a rough texture can prevent unwanted shifting during use.

Considering the use of furniture anchors or grips on the legs can provide additional stability. These accessories can be discreetly attached and may keep the seating firmly in place.

Regular cleaning with appropriate solutions can help maintain the integrity of the surface, enhancing the grip properties. It’s advisable to avoid using furniture polish, as it can contribute to a slippery finish.

Lastly, adjusting the arrangement of surrounding items can limit the sliding effect. By ensuring there’s no excessive pressure or movement from adjacent pieces, I can achieve a more secure seating experience.

Understanding the Causes of Slipping on Leather

The primary reason for movement on smooth surfaces lies in the natural characteristics of animal-derived materials. These materials often possess a slick texture that increases frictionless motion. Environmental factors play a significant role; humidity and temperature can affect the surface properties, making it more or less prone to slipping.

Another aspect to consider is the choice of clothing and accessories. Fabrics such as silk or polyester can exacerbate the issue due to their low friction coefficients against slick surfaces. Body positioning also impacts stability; shifting weight or reclining at certain angles can create an imbalance.

Worn-out upholstery contributes as well. Over time, the finish may lose grip and lead to a challenging experience. Maintenance routines should address this by regularly cleaning and conditioning to restore texture and reduce slippiness.

In addition, how we interact with the seat, such as shifting quickly or using excessive force to get up, can increase the likelihood of movement. Being mindful of these behaviors may mitigate unwanted sliding occurrences.

Choosing the Right Fabrics for Added Grip

Opt for textured materials such as microfibers or tweed. These fabrics provide friction, reducing the likelihood of slipping. Their rougher surface contrasts with the smoothness of polished surfaces, enhancing stability.

Regular Maintenance Tips for Leather Seating

Wipe surfaces regularly with a soft, damp cloth to prevent dust and grime accumulation. Use a mild soap solution for deeper cleaning, ensuring it’s not too wet to avoid saturation. Following any cleaning, always dry the area gently.

Conditioning Treatments

Apply conditioner specifically designed for animal hides every six months. This process hydrates the material and enhances its suppleness, helping avoid dryness and cracking. Choose a product free from harsh chemicals to maintain the integrity of the upholstery.

Creating a Shield Against Stains

Utilize a protective spray formulated for animal skins to repel spills and stains. Reapply this treatment periodically based on usage and environmental factors. Testing any new product on a hidden area guarantees compatibility and desired results before widespread application.

FAQ:

What are some common causes of sliding on leather furniture?

Sliding on leather furniture can be caused by several factors, including the type of leather, the finish applied, and the presence of dust or dirt. Smooth leather surfaces tend to be more slippery, especially if they have a glossy finish. Additionally, if the furniture is placed on a slick floor or if the fabric of clothing worn while sitting is also smooth, it can contribute to the sliding issue.

How can I reduce slippage on my leather sofa?

There are several methods to reduce slippage on leather sofas. One option is to use anti-slip cushions or mats underneath the upholstery. These items can be placed between the leather and the seating surface to create friction. Another approach is to apply a leather conditioner that enhances grip, or consider using textured throws or blankets over the leather. Additionally, keeping the sofa clean and free from dust can improve friction and reduce sliding.

Are there specific products I can use to prevent sliding on leather furniture?

Yes, there are various products specifically designed to prevent sliding on leather furniture. Anti-slip sprays or coatings can be applied to the leather to increase friction. Alternatively, you can use silicone pads or gripper mats that are intended for use with furniture to provide additional grip. It’s important to choose products that are safe for leather and won’t damage the material.

Can I use ordinary household items to stop sliding on leather furniture?

Absolutely! Some common household items can help minimize sliding on leather furniture. Items like rubber shelf liners, non-slip carpet pads, or even strips of fabric tape can be placed underneath cushions or on the surfaces of the leather seat. Additionally, using rugs under the furniture can provide extra traction and prevent sliding.

Is it possible to change the leather finish to reduce sliding?

Changing the leather finish is an option, but it typically requires professional help and can be costly. While it’s possible to apply a textured finish or a non-slip treatment, it’s crucial to consult with a leather specialist to understand the impacts on the quality and appearance of the furniture. Alternatively, exploring non-invasive methods like adding cushions or throws might be more practical for improving grip on leather surfaces.
